Objective:

To compare the in vitro bioactivity between a generic lactobacillin granules drug and three commercial lactobacillin granules drugs, this study investigated inhibition on pathogenic bacteria, the growth promoting effect on probiotics, and establish a method to evaluate the in vitro bioactivity consistency of drugs that regulate gut microbiota.

Methods:

Two culture systems were set up to investigate the inhibitory effect on pathogenic bacteria and the growth promoting effect on probiotics by lactobacillin granules. The in vitro bioactivity consistency of four products was evaluated by microbial growth curve and analyzed by two-way analysis of variance with Dunnett-t test.

Results:

No significant difference (P>0.05) was observed on inhibition of Staphylococcus aureus and growth promotion of Lactobacillus rhamnosus between the generic lactobacillin granules and the commercial lactobacillin granules.

Conclusion:

This method could be used to evaluate the in vitro bioactivity of drugs that regulate gut microbiota, and provided guidance on relevant drug development and quality evaluation.
